#769df8 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#769df8 is composed of 46.3% red, 61.6% green and 97.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.4% cyan, 36.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 2.7% black. It has a hue angle of 222 degrees, a saturation of 90.3% and a lightness of 71.8%. #769df8 color hex could be obtained by blending #ecffff with #003bf1. Closest websafe color is: #6699ff.

Shades and Tints of #769df8

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01040c is the darkest color, while #f9faff is the lightest one.

Tones of #769df8

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b3b5bb is the less saturated color, while #709bfe is the most saturated one.
